Поделиться через


SMALLDATETIMEFROMPARTS (Transact-SQL)

Относится к:S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ceAzure Synapse AnalyticsАналитическая платформа (PDW)SQL база данных в Microsoft Fabric

Возвращает значение smalldatetime, соответствующее указанной дате и времени.

Соглашения о синтаксисе Transact-SQL

Синтаксис

SMALLDATETIMEFROMPARTS ( year, month, day, hour, minute )  

Аргументы

year
Целочисленное выражение, задающее год.

month
Целочисленное выражение, задающее месяц.

day
Целочисленное выражение, задающее день.

hour
Целочисленное выражение, задающее часы.

minute
Целочисленное выражение, задающее минуты.

Типы возвращаемых данных

smalldatetime

Замечания

Эта функция действует как конструктор полностью инициализированного значения smalldatetime. Если аргументы недопустимы, то возникает ошибка. Если требуемые аргументы имеют значение NULL, возвращается NULL.

Эта функция может быть удалена на серверы SQL Server 2012 (11.x) и выше. Он не удален на серверы с версией ниже SQL Server 2012 (11.x).

Примеры

SELECT SMALLDATETIMEFROMPARTS ( 2010, 12, 31, 23, 59 ) AS Result  

Вот результирующий набор.

Result  
---------------------------  
2010-12-31 23:59:00  
  
(1 row(s) affected)